Who are these guidelines for?

Presenting authors of abstracts selected for Short Oral Presentation in Rapid Fire Session.

The Rapid Fire Session is an exciting, fast-paced format where you’ll have the opportunity to deliver a brief yet impactful presentation of your abstract. You’ll have 3 minutes to showcase your work with up to 3 slides. (Presentation should include the abstract title, Background and Aims, methods, Results and Conclusions and Impact). Please focus on the importance aspects of your work.

Short Oral  Presentation

How long: 3 minutes

Where: Short Oral Presentations will take place in the session hall.

How: Presenters will present from their power point presentation.

The presentation should be with a maximum of 3 slides and include the abstract title, Background and Aims, methods, Results and Conclusions and Impact
